Raquel has gross pay of $732 and federal tax withholdings of $62. Determine Raquel’s net pay if she has the additional items wit
IceJOKER [234]

Answer:

The net pay of the Raquel be $601 .

Step-by-step explanation:

As given

Raquel has gross pay of $732 and federal tax withholdings of $62.

Social Security tax that is 6.2% of her gross pay .

6.2% is written in the decimal form.

= \frac{6.2}{100}

= 0.062

Social Security tax = 0.062 × Gross pay

                              = 0.062 × 732

                               = $ 45.38 (Approx)

As given

Medicare tax that is 1.45% of her gross pay .

1.45% is written in the decimal form.

= \frac{1.45}{100}

= 0.0145

Medicare Tax = 0.0145 × Gross pay

                       = 0.0145 × 732

                       = $ 10.6 (Approx)

As given

State tax that is 21% of her federal tax.

21% is written in the decimal form.

= \frac{21}{100}

= 0.21

State tax = 0.21 × Federal tax

              = 0.21 × 62

              = $13.02

Total amount of the tax = Federal tax + Social Security tax + Medicare Tax + State tax

Putting all the values in the above

                                      = $62 + $45.38 +$10.6 + $13.02

                                      = $ 131

Raquel’s net pay = Gross pay - Total amount of taxes

                             = $732 - $131

                             = $ 601

Therefore the net pay of the Raquel be $601 .
